Bruce Willis

Actor and musician Bruce Willis is well known for playing wisecracking or hard-edged characters, most often in spectacular action films. In total, he's appeared in films with a budget more than $2.5 billion dollars. Walter Bruce Willis was born on the 19th of March, 1955, in Idar-Oberstein in West Germany, to a German mother, Marlene Kassel, and an American father, David Andrew Willis (from Carneys Point, New Jersey) and was living at the United States military base. His family moved to the United States shortly following his birth. He grew up in Penns Grove (New Jersey) where his mother was bank clerk while his father was an electrician as well as a worker in a factory. Willis started to take an interest in drama arts during his high school. He was "discovered" while working in an New York City cafe. Then, he was a part of numerous off-Broadway productions. He was bartending one night when a casting director noticed his charisma and asked for his services as the bartender for a small movie. Willis was part of countless auditions before finding the role in the popular romantic comedy, Moonlighting (1985), as David Addison. The sly and wise-cracking P.I. is seen by some as an attempt to play the part of the hard-boiled NYC detective "John McClane" in the monster hit Die Hard (1988), in the film, Willis his character fought an gang of vicious international thieves within a Los Angeles skyscraper. In the sequel, Die Hard 2 (1990), Willis reprised his character as McClane. The story was set in Washington's Dulles International Airport where a group of rebellious Special Forces soldiers are trying to get back an unjust South American general. The sequel, Die Hard with avengeance (1995) was a success. It starred Samuel L. Jackson as an obnoxious Harlem shop owner who has to help McClane during a terrorist bombing campaign that took place on a hot New York day.
